Technical Glitch Resolved, AP Government Employees Salaries Paid

Amaravati: The Ministry of Finance, Government of Andhra Pradesh released a note to clarify that it was not due to lack of funds that the AP Government employee's weren't paid salaries as relayed and shared in several TV channels and Social Media groups.

These payments are usually made by Reserve Bank of India (RBI) e-Kuber on the 1st of every month. Accordingly, all districts' pensions and salary files were sent to the RBI on July 31. By afternoon on the 1st of August, pensioners were paid and so were some salaries files were also cleared and paid.

Due to some technical reasons, the e-seal certificates were not working and the rest of the files were delayed. Immediate steps were taken to resolve this technical issue and the remaining employees were paid their salaries.
